isUninitialized
See source codeCall this inside a computed signal function to determine whether it is the first time the function is being called.
Mainly useful for incremental signal computation.
function isUninitialized(value: any): value is UNINITIALIZEDExample
const count = atom('count', 0)
const double = computed('double', (prevValue) => {
if (isUninitialized(prevValue)) {
print('First time!')
}
return count.get() * 2
})Parameters
| Name | Description |
|---|---|
| The value to check. |
Returns
value is UNINITIALIZEDPrev
isSignalNext
localStorageAtom